Verse (21:42), Word 5 - Quranic Grammar

__

The fifth word of verse (21:42) is divided into 2 morphological segments. A conjunction and noun. The prefixed conjunction wa is usually translated as "and". The noun is masculine and is in the genitive case (مجرور). The noun's triliteral root is nūn hā rā (ن ه ر).

Verse (21:42)

The analysis above refers to the 42nd verse of chapter 21 (sūrat l-anbiyāa):

Sahih International: Say, "Who can protect you at night or by day from the Most Merciful?" But they are, from the remembrance of their Lord, turning away.
